Magnesium's Role in Heart Health
Magnesium, a crucial mineral, is involved in over 300 bodily biochemical reactions. It is essential for maintaining a healthy cardiovascular system, muscles, and nerves. Low magnesium levels (hypomagnesemia) have been linked to heart-related issues, including elevated blood pressure, irregular heartbeats, and abnormal lipid levels, which increase the risk of cardiovascular disease (CVD).
Magnesium supports heart health in several ways. It helps regulate blood pressure by relaxing blood vessels, improves the function of the blood vessel lining (endothelial function), and supports a healthy metabolism. Adequate magnesium intake, whether from food or supplements, may offer support to individuals with high cholesterol by addressing these underlying factors.
Potential Benefits of Magnesium for High Cholesterol
Research into magnesium's effects on cholesterol suggests several areas of potential benefit:
- Enhancing "Good" Cholesterol (HDL): Some studies show that magnesium supplementation, especially at higher doses (≥ 300 mg/day) and over a longer duration (≥ 84 days), can increase high-density lipoprotein (HDL) cholesterol. HDL is known for protecting against cardiovascular disease.
- Reducing Inflammation: High cholesterol is often connected with chronic low-grade inflammation. Magnesium has anti-inflammatory properties, and studies show that higher magnesium intake is associated with lower levels of C-reactive protein (CRP), an inflammation marker. Magnesium may indirectly support healthier lipid levels by helping reduce inflammation.
- Improving Insulin Sensitivity: Magnesium is involved in insulin regulation. Improved insulin sensitivity is linked to healthier cholesterol profiles, especially lower LDL and triglycerides. Magnesium supplementation may help normalize these lipid levels through this mechanism.
- Impact on LDL and Triglycerides: While some older studies reported reduced LDL and triglycerides with magnesium, recent meta-analyses found no significant effect on these lipid markers in the general population. The benefit is more consistently related to boosting HDL cholesterol. However, some studies on specific patient groups, such as those with diabetes, have shown reductions in total and LDL cholesterol with magnesium oxide or combined supplements.
Magnesium and Statin Medications
Many people with high cholesterol use statin medication as a primary treatment. A key concern is how magnesium supplementation interacts with statins. Oral magnesium supplements are generally considered safe to take alongside statins. However, the timing is important to ensure proper absorption. It is recommended to separate magnesium supplements from statin doses by at least 2 hours.
Some research suggests a synergistic effect. A study on patients with hyperlipidemia found that combining magnesium with atorvastatin resulted in improved lipid profiles (higher HDL, lower LDL and triglycerides) compared to atorvastatin alone. Magnesium may also help reduce statin-related side effects like muscle pain or weakness, as magnesium deficiency can exacerbate these issues.
Comparison of Magnesium Supplementation vs. Statin Therapy
| Feature | Magnesium Supplementation | Statin Therapy |
|---|---|---|
| Primary Mechanism | Acts as an enzyme cofactor, reduces inflammation, improves insulin sensitivity, and activates LCAT to raise HDL. | Inhibits HMG-CoA reductase, a key enzyme in the liver's cholesterol production pathway, to lower LDL. |
| Effect on LDL | May have a modest or indirect effect, but results are mixed and not consistent across studies or populations. | Clinically proven to significantly and reliably lower LDL levels. |
| Effect on HDL | Can significantly increase HDL levels, especially at higher doses. | May slightly increase HDL, but it is not its primary function. |
| Effect on Triglycerides | Evidence is mixed, though some studies show a decrease, especially in combination with other nutrients. | Can help lower triglycerides. |
| Adverse Effects | Generally mild, such as gastrointestinal upset (diarrhea), especially at high doses. | Potential for muscle pain, weakness, and elevated liver enzymes in some individuals. |
| Interaction with Statins | Generally safe, but timing should be separated by at least two hours to avoid absorption interference. | Potential synergistic effect with magnesium, which may improve lipid profiles and mitigate muscle side effects. |
Dietary and Lifestyle Considerations
Magnesium should not be viewed as a standalone solution for high cholesterol. It is one component of a comprehensive heart-healthy approach that includes diet, exercise, and, if needed, medication.
- Dietary Sources: Good sources of magnesium include leafy green vegetables (e.g., spinach), nuts (almonds, cashews), seeds, legumes, and whole grains. A balanced diet provides numerous nutrients that support cardiovascular health.
- Exercise: Regular physical activity is beneficial for heart health and can help increase beneficial HDL cholesterol while lowering harmful LDL and triglycerides.
- Weight Management: Losing excess weight, especially around the waist, can positively impact cholesterol levels.
- Other Supplements: Other supplements like omega-3 fatty acids, plant sterols, and soluble fiber have also been shown to help manage cholesterol.
